WebTo subtract fractions with different denominators, you need to find a common denominator. This can be done by identifying the least common multiple of the two denominators. After rewriting the fractions so they both have the common denominator, you can subtract the numerators as you would with any two fractions. WebHere are some steps to follow: Check to see if the fractions have the same denominator. If they don't have the same denominator, then convert them to equivalent fractions with the same denominator. Once they have the same denominator, add or subtract the numbers in the numerator. Write your answer with the new numerator over the denominator.
